Default Video: Kopp AJ vs Froggy Bottom SJ

Saying goodbye to my 2015 Kevin Kopp Advanced jumbo (Adirondack / Madagascar) and coincidentally entering just this weekend is a new (to me) 2012 Froggy Bottom SJ deluxe.

Both outstanding instruments, and similar enough to pique my interest in doing a comparison video.

I’m interested to see what you think about them and their similarities and differences.

I much prefer the Kopp, beautiful tone with the added clarity and punch Madi imparts (which to my ear is often somewhere between Indian rosewood and mahogany). The Froggy has a thicker, darker tone but lacks the definition of the Kopp. The Kopp also looks absolutely beautiful with that burst.
